About California High Speed Rail- CP1

The California High-Speed Rail Authority’s Construction Package 1 (CP1) is the first significant construction contract executed on the Initial Operating Section of the High-Speed Rail project in California’s Central Valley.

The CP1 construction area is a 32‑mile stretch between Avenue 19 in Madera County to East American Avenue in Fresno County, including major work elements in downtown Fresno. It includes 12 roadway / railroad grade separations, two mainline viaducts, one tunnel, realignments of existing railroad tracks, utility relocations, roadway relocations, two trench sections, and a major river crossing over the San Joaquin River.

Responsibilities
  • Inspect to contract specifications the quality of concrete mix designs, construction submittals, testing procedures, etc.
  • Inspect concrete steel reinforcement and form work on bridge decks, beams, box culverts, columns, footings, utilities and roadways.
  • Develop understanding/working knowledge of company quality control program, company standards, procedures, codes, etc. required to perform assigned work.
  • Perform inspections and witness tests applicable to discipline to determine acceptability of work.
  • Assist in maintaining work performance records, inspection records and other related items; assure correctness of all documents.
  • Assist in preparation/implementation of quality control procedures, i.e., inspection instructions, control measuring and test equipment, etc.
  • Assist in coordinating quality control inspection schedules with other department schedules.
  • Participate in internal/external quality control audits.
  • Assist in reviewing purchase documents to ensure compliance with quality control requirements.
  • Perform additional assignments per supervisor's direction.
Requirements
  • High school diploma or GED certification
  • 5 or more years of experience in support of heavy civil construction testing, inspection, supervision or management in support of large public works projects.
  • Experienced with U.S. construction standards and codes
  • An understanding and experience with contract specifications as they apply to quality control and/or assurance (preferred)
  • Experience with Microsoft Office (preferred)
  • ACI or other industry related certifications (preferred)
